Chalice Well
Barry Truax
Notes de programme
Chalice Well takes the listener on an imaginary journey beneath the holy well at the foot of Glastonbury Tor, thought to be the original island of Avalon from Arthurian legend, passing through cavernous chambers filled with rushing and trickling water, including the chamber of the feminine spirit, the glass chamber, then to the gates of the underworld where Joseph of Arimathea placed the chalice known as the Holy Grail, and finally coming to rest in the space where wind and water, the masculine and the feminine, are combined.
